Job Description

As an Internal Audit Intern supporting the MEAAPAC region, you will work closely with the Internal Audit team to assist in audit planning, execution, and reporting activities across multiple countries. You will contribute to strengthening internal controls, risk management, and governance frameworks while gaining exposure to executive-level interactions and regional operations. This internship offers a unique opportunity to understand challenges in hotel operations and internal audit adds value in a complex, international hospitality environment.

  • Regional Coordination: Assist in synchronizing internal audit efforts across the MEAAPAC regions, ensuring alignment with global goals and the smooth execution of audit missions and reports communication.
  • Audit Support: Assist in the preparation and execution of internal audits, including walkthroughs, testing of controls, and documentation of audit evidence.
  • Internal Control Assessment: Support the preparation and the completion of the yearly self-assessment process at hotel and corporate level.
  • Data Analysis & Reporting: Help analyse audit data, prepare summaries, dashboards, and draft sections of audit reports.
  • Administrative Assistance: Provide operational support by organizing meetings, maintaining project timelines, and handling documentation related to sustainability projects
  • Follow-up & Action Tracking: Assist in monitoring the implementation of agreed management action plans and tracking remediation progress.
  • Best Practice Sharing: Contribute to identifying and sharing good practices observed across audits within the MEAAPAC and other regions.
  • Ad-hoc Support: Provide support to the Internal Audit team on special projects, investigations, or governance initiatives as required
